Information: Official Umbro LOSC Lille Home Football Shirt from 2011/12, as worn by 'Les Dogues' when they finished 3rd in Ligue 1 behind PSG and Montpellier, whilst again qualifying for the UEFA Champions League. The reverse of the shirt boasts the nameset of Eden Hazard, who finished that season as top scorer with 22 goals in all competitions. this would turn out to be his last season in France, as he made a big money move to English giants Chelsea that summer. To help preserve and protect your beloved football kit, please carefully follow these care guidelines:
- Cool wash (30°C)
- Air dry. Do not tumble dry
- Wash inside out
- Do not bleach
- Do not use fabric softener
- Cool iron or steam
